In Sublime Text for example, or also in Launchy and Wox which are similar launchers to Cerebro, you get fuzzy search that works like this: if I type "abcd", it searches for anything with an a in it, then a b in it occurring after the a, then a c occurring after the b, etc.
This allows for very quick filtering when you have similar paths, like say you have "SomethingLongBlue" and "SomethingLongRed" and you want to access the second one, you can type somr and it will filter both from som and narrow it down to the red one with the r.
I don't know if this should be by default or as an option, I think by default is good enough and I am happy to provide a patch to the search function but I wanted to hear first what you think.
